Star Pitt defensive lineman Jalen Twyman has opted out of the college football season and says he will return home to Virginia and prepare for next spring’s NFL draft.
In a tweet titled “Forever Thankful,” posted yesterday, Twyman writes “This isn’t about Covid-19. This is about my family’s needs, now and in the future.” He adds that he promised both his mother and Pitt coach Pat Narduzzi that he will complete his degree in communications at Pitt and signs off with the words, “Forever a Pitt man!”
Narduzzi tweeted, “We will miss you, Jaylen. Always a Pitt Man. Forever a Panther.”
